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kingham to Apsley start from as little as £16.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kingham to Apsley are available for £54.80 one way, or £109.60 return

Facilities at Kingham Station

For ease of travel, Kingham Station has a ticket office open from the early hours on weekdays and Saturday, complemented by ticket machines and accessible options for those using smartcards. While the station might lack in the array of shops or ATMs, it ensures your journey stays smooth with essential refreshment facilities. Public payphones are available, though Wi-Fi is not provided. Despite the absence of a structured waiting room, sufficient seating areas ensure comfort while you wait for your train.

Step-free access is present but somewhat limited, as platform 2 is only reachable by a step bridge. Assistance for passengers with reduced mobility is available, and ramps for train access make the station inclusive for everyone. Booking your assistance up to two hours in advance is recommended, which can be done online for a hassle-free experience.

Parking, Cycling, and Refreshments

Your parking needs are catered to with 140 spaces in the station's car park, operating 24 hours across the week under APCOA Parking. Though the parking accommodation does not offer designated accessible spaces, blue badge holders are exempted from charges. For cyclists, Kingham offers storage for up to six cycles with secure stands and CCTV surveillance, ensuring your bicycle remains safe.

Transport Links from Kingham

Kingham Station seamlessly integrates various transport options for your onward journey. Rail replacement services are conveniently located in front of the station building for those times when train travel isn’t possible. For broader connectivity, plan your bus trips using the printable guide from the National Rail website. Air travel links are excellently handled by changing trains at Reading for Heathrow and Gatwick, or at Bristol Temple Meads for Bristol Airport.

Station Facilities and Services at Apsley

The station is equipped with ticket offices with varied opening times, ensuring flexibility for early risers and those travelling during late hours. Ticket machines are also available for quick purchases, including accessible options outside the Booking Hall. For online ticket buyers, collection is made simple using these machines.

Travelers will find assistance from staff at the help points and ticket office during operating hours, stated clearly from early morning till evening on most days. CCTV surveillance, step-free access, and a few provisions for disabled parking highlight the station's commitment to safety and accessibility.

While there is no waiting room, seating areas are provided to offer comfort before embarking on your train journey. Refreshment facilities, including a coffee shop open during morning peaks, provide a caffeinated pick-me-up, although those in search of a larger culinary selection might need to explore beyond the station.

Transport Connections and Accessibility

For those seeking transport beyond the rail network, Apsley Train Station is conveniently located near bus stops on the main road at the end of the footpath. In cases of train service interruptions, rail replacement services are accessible from nearby London Road bus stops, offering seamless connections. Though the station lacks a designated taxi service, free phones are available for taxi bookings.
